Job description

We are seeking a highly skilled and experienced HSE Engineer to join our site team in Abu Dhabi.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Ensure the Contractors implement and follow the approved HSE Plan and various procedures and legal requirements applicable to the project.
  • Play a proactive role in the identification of various project risks and communicate them to contractors to ensure that suitable and sufficient controls are taken proactively to eliminate or mitigate them.
  • Actively involve themselves in the various site meetings including HSE.
  • Develop and implement an effective HSEproactive monitoring program. This includes joint inspection with Contractors Audits Quarterly audits Fire safety audits meetings and presentations in addition to producing all relevant HSEreports as per the clients HSErepresentative request.
  • Participate with relevant parties during the HSE incident investigation process and ensure reportable incidents as per the statutory requirements (ADOSH-SF) are reported by the concerned parties to the appropriate regulatory authority.
  • Ensure project HSE monthly reports are reviewed and forwarded to project management inthe previously accepted format and time period. This will include KPIs statistical information for analysis and proactive trending.
  • Prepare and disseminate HSE alerts by using the PM template in conjunction with and approval of Project Management HSErepresentative.
  • Evaluate monitor and manage the HSE behaviour and performance of the principal contractor. Also take suitable steps to ensure that a positive HSE culture is developed at the site.
  • Generate review and approve project HSE documents such as HSE plans HSE enforcement notes and close out Inspections HSE Management walk and Audit close out.
  • Review and approve all risk assessments and method statements and give the necessary advice to the PMC.
  • Ensure that contractors have carried out task-specific risk assessments and method statements for all site activities.
  • Ensure that contractors communicate all controls in the risk assessment and method statement to their personnel who are involved in carrying out the task.
  • Ensure in case of non-compliance with the approved procedure an HSE Enforcement Notice is issued and closed within the accepted time frame.
  • Chair regular HSE Meetings at the site and ensure that the minutes are prepared maintained and distributed to all concerned parties.
  • Positive engagement with competent authority during any site visit.
  • Participate inthe selection process of HSE staff in line with PMC OSH competency guidelines and obtain the final approval from the PMC OSHTeam.
  • Ensure all concerned parties HSEMS - ADOSHare registered with the competent authority.
  • Ensure all HSE permits and NOCs are obtained and up to date.
  • Ensure all project-related HSE documents are up to date such as HSE Plan etc.
  • Ensure that all applicable federal laws local laws and ministerial orders are followed by all concerned parties on the site. Also research and distribute all revisions and legislation that will affect the site.
  • Provide recommendations to the PMCTeam to issue HSE appreciation certificates to recognize good HSE performance and achievements.
  • Generate review and approve project HSE documents and procedures such as HSE plans and pertinent project-specific procedures HSE Objectives and Targets Legal Compliance Register HSE enforcement notices HSE Inspections Management walk reports and Audit reports and ensure follow-up to close all the outstanding issues/reports within the agreed timeframe this includes updating all HSE documents and reports on the system (E.g. Asite Aconex etc.)
Qualifications :
  • The candidate shall have a minimum of 12 years of vivid experience in the HSE domain.
  • Minimum 3 years of relevant work experience as an HSE Engineer accompanied by HSE related Masters Degree from an accredited University; or
  • Minimum 4 years of relevant work experience as an HSE Engineer accompanied by HSE-related Bachelors Degree from an accredited University; or NEBHSE Diploma.
  • Minimum 5 years relevant work experience as an HSE Engineer accompanied by Post-Secondary HSE Qualification (NVQ level 4/5).
  • ISO 45001: 2018 Lead Auditor Qualification
  • NEBOSH IGC
  • OSHAD (ADOSH) Safety Practitioner Course
  • Previous experience in High-rise Building construction (Oil & Gas experience not accepted)
  • Previous experience as a Supervision Consultant /PMC HSE
